, Condition limite dédiée : Les fortes singularités rencontrées sur l'axe de symétrie ne permettent pas l'utilisation d'une méthodologie usuelle et demandent la mise en place d'un traitement spécifique de la limite comme proposé Section
Les modèles et méthodes ont été intégrés dans le code SIERRA, parallélisé pour l'occasion en mémoire partagée comme décrit Section 8.2 et intégrant les dernières normes FORTRAN ,
, Comme présenté dans les derniers chapitres, l'ensemble de ces apports permet aujourd'hui la conduite de simulations d'écoulements diphasiques polydispersés en taille et en vitesse en configurations industrielles. Cela ouvre la voie à des simulations à la prédictibilité accrue pour l'étude notamment des performances et de la stabilité des moteurs-fusées à propergol solide
